Resistance Rotary Tube Furnace Microwave Frequency 2.45 Gigahertz, 314 Stainless Steel
HY-ZG1512E uses 314 stainless steel as chamber material.
Quartz carrier can be rotated inside the working tube which ensures that sample material can be heated more evenly.
The alumina ceramic fiber insulation structure inside the furnace chamber increases temperature uniformity while improving energy efficiency.
HY-ZG1512E is equiped with furnace door shutdown sensor, users can operate with more safety.
There are over temperature alarm to prevent magnetron damage.
HY-ZG1512E is suitable for a range of applications that require processing flexibility with fast heatup and recovery rates.
